// Helper for intercepting a resource request to the given URL and capturing the
// response headers and body.
//
// Note that after the request completes, the original requestor (e.g. the
// renderer) will see an injected request failure (this is easier to accomplish
// than forwarding the intercepted response to the original requestor),
class RequestInterceptor {
 public:
  // Start intercepting requests to |url_to_intercept|.
  explicit RequestInterceptor(const GURL& url_to_intercept)
      : url_to_intercept_(url_to_intercept),
        interceptor_(
            base::BindRepeating(&RequestInterceptor::InterceptorCallback,
                                base::Unretained(this))) {
    DCHECK_CURRENTLY_ON(BrowserThread::UI);
    DCHECK(url_to_intercept.is_valid());

    pending_test_client_remote_ = test_client_.CreateRemote();
  }

  ~RequestInterceptor() {
    WaitForCleanUpOnInterceptorThread(
        network::mojom::URLResponseHead::New(), "",
        network::URLLoaderCompletionStatus(net::ERR_NOT_IMPLEMENTED));
  }

  // No copy constructor or assignment operator.
  RequestInterceptor(const RequestInterceptor&) = delete;
  RequestInterceptor& operator=(const RequestInterceptor&) = delete;

  // Waits until a request gets intercepted and completed.
  void WaitForRequestCompletion() {
    DCHECK_CURRENTLY_ON(BrowserThread::UI);
    DCHECK(!request_completed_);
    test_client_.RunUntilComplete();

    // Read the intercepted response body into |body_|.
    if (test_client_.completion_status().error_code == net::OK) {
      base::RunLoop run_loop;
      ReadBody(run_loop.QuitClosure());
      run_loop.Run();
    }

    // Wait until IO cleanup completes.
    WaitForCleanUpOnInterceptorThread(test_client_.response_head().Clone(),
                                      body_, test_client_.completion_status());

    // Mark the request as completed (for DCHECK purposes).
    request_completed_ = true;
  }

  const network::URLLoaderCompletionStatus& completion_status() const {
    DCHECK_CURRENTLY_ON(BrowserThread::UI);
    DCHECK(request_completed_);
    return test_client_.completion_status();
  }

  const network::mojom::URLResponseHeadPtr& response_head() const {
    DCHECK_CURRENTLY_ON(BrowserThread::UI);
    DCHECK(request_completed_);
    return test_client_.response_head();
  }

  const std::string& response_body() const {
    DCHECK_CURRENTLY_ON(BrowserThread::UI);
    DCHECK(request_completed_);
    return body_;
  }

  void Verify(OrbExpectations expectations,
              const std::string& expected_resource_body) {
    if (0 != (expectations & kShouldBeBlocked)) {
      // Verify that the body is empty.
      EXPECT_EQ("", response_body());
      EXPECT_EQ(0, completion_status().decoded_body_length);

      // Verify that the console message would have been printed.
      EXPECT_TRUE(completion_status().should_report_orb_blocking);

      // Verify the response code & headers, which depends on whether the
      // response is blocked as an error, or as an empty response.
      if (0 != (expectations & kBlockResourcesAsError)) {
        ASSERT_EQ(net::ERR_BLOCKED_BY_ORB, completion_status().error_code);
        ASSERT_FALSE(response_head());
      } else {
        ASSERT_EQ(net::OK, completion_status().error_code);

        // Verify that response has no content.
        EXPECT_EQ(0u, response_head()->content_length);

        // Verify that response headers have been sanitized.
        size_t iter = 0;
        std::string name, value;
        EXPECT_FALSE(response_head()->headers->EnumerateHeaderLines(
            &iter, &name, &value));
        EXPECT_EQ(iter, 0u);
      }
    } else {
      ASSERT_EQ(net::OK, completion_status().error_code);
      EXPECT_FALSE(completion_status().should_report_orb_blocking);
      EXPECT_EQ(expected_resource_body, response_body());
    }
  }

  void InjectRequestInitiator(const url::Origin& request_initiator) {
    request_initiator_to_inject_ = request_initiator;
  }

  void InjectFetchMode(network::mojom::RequestMode request_mode) {
    request_mode_to_inject_ = request_mode;
  }

 private:
  void ReadBody(base::OnceClosure completion_callback) {
    std::string buffer(128, '\0');
    size_t actually_read_bytes = 0;
    MojoResult result = test_client_.response_body().ReadData(
        MOJO_READ_DATA_FLAG_NONE, base::as_writable_byte_span(buffer),
        actually_read_bytes);

    bool got_all_data = false;
    switch (result) {
      case MOJO_RESULT_OK:
        if (actually_read_bytes != 0) {
          body_ += buffer.substr(0, actually_read_bytes);
          got_all_data = false;
        } else {
          got_all_data = true;
        }
        break;
      case MOJO_RESULT_SHOULD_WAIT:
        // There is no data to be read or discarded (and the producer is still
        // open).
        got_all_data = false;
        break;
      case MOJO_RESULT_FAILED_PRECONDITION:
        // The data pipe producer handle has been closed.
        got_all_data = true;
        break;
      default:
        NOTREACHED() << "Unexpected mojo error: " << result;
    }

    if (!got_all_data) {
      base::SingleThreadTaskRunner::GetCurrentDefault()->PostTask(
          FROM_HERE,
          base::BindOnce(&RequestInterceptor::ReadBody, base::Unretained(this),
                         std::move(completion_callback)));
    } else {
      std::move(completion_callback).Run();
    }
  }

  bool InterceptorCallback(URLLoaderInterceptor::RequestParams* params) {
    DCHECK(params);

    if (url_to_intercept_ != params->url_request.url) {
      return false;
    }

    // Prevent more than one intercept.
    if (request_intercepted_) {
      return false;
    }
    request_intercepted_ = true;
    interceptor_task_runner_ =
        base::SingleThreadTaskRunner::GetCurrentDefault();

    // Modify |params| if requested.
    if (request_initiator_to_inject_.has_value()) {
      params->url_request.request_initiator = request_initiator_to_inject_;
    }
    if (request_mode_to_inject_.has_value()) {
      params->url_request.mode = request_mode_to_inject_.value();
    }

    // Inject |test_client_| into the request.
    DCHECK(!original_client_);
    original_client_ = std::move(params->client);
    test_client_remote_.Bind(std::move(pending_test_client_remote_));
    test_client_receiver_ =
        std::make_unique<mojo::Receiver<network::mojom::URLLoaderClient>>(
            test_client_remote_.get(),
            params->client.BindNewPipeAndPassReceiver());

    // Forward the request to the original URLLoaderFactory.
    return false;
  }

  void WaitForCleanUpOnInterceptorThread(
      network::mojom::URLResponseHeadPtr response_head,
      std::string response_body,
      network::URLLoaderCompletionStatus status) {
    DCHECK_CURRENTLY_ON(BrowserThread::UI);

    if (cleanup_done_) {
      return;
    }

    if (interceptor_task_runner_) {
      base::RunLoop run_loop;
      interceptor_task_runner_->PostTaskAndReply(
          FROM_HERE,
          base::BindOnce(&RequestInterceptor::CleanUpOnInterceptorThread,
                         base::Unretained(this), std::move(response_head),
                         response_body, status),
          run_loop.QuitClosure());
      run_loop.Run();
    }

    cleanup_done_ = true;
  }

  void CleanUpOnInterceptorThread(
      network::mojom::URLResponseHeadPtr response_head,
      std::string response_body,
      network::URLLoaderCompletionStatus status) {
    if (!request_intercepted_) {
      return;
    }

    // Tell the |original_client_| that the request has completed (and that it
    // can release its URLLoaderClient.
    if (status.error_code == net::OK) {
      mojo::ScopedDataPipeProducerHandle producer_handle;
      mojo::ScopedDataPipeConsumerHandle consumer_handle;
      ASSERT_EQ(mojo::CreateDataPipe(response_body.size() + 1, producer_handle,
                                     consumer_handle),
                MOJO_RESULT_OK);
      original_client_->OnReceiveResponse(
          std::move(response_head), std::move(consumer_handle), std::nullopt);

      EXPECT_EQ(MOJO_RESULT_OK, producer_handle->WriteAllData(
                                    base::as_byte_span(response_body)));
    }
    original_client_->OnComplete(status);

    // Reset all temporary mojo bindings.
    original_client_.reset();
    test_client_receiver_.reset();
    test_client_remote_.reset();
  }

  const GURL url_to_intercept_;
  URLLoaderInterceptor interceptor_;

  std::optional<url::Origin> request_initiator_to_inject_;
  std::optional<network::mojom::RequestMode> request_mode_to_inject_;

  // |pending_test_client_remote_| below is used to transition results of
  // |test_client_.CreateRemote()| into IO thread.
  mojo::PendingRemote<network::mojom::URLLoaderClient>
      pending_test_client_remote_;

  // UI thread state:
  network::TestURLLoaderClient test_client_;
  std::string body_;
  bool request_completed_ = false;
  bool cleanup_done_ = false;

  // Interceptor thread state:
  mojo::Remote<network::mojom::URLLoaderClient> original_client_;
  bool request_intercepted_ = false;
  scoped_refptr<base::SingleThreadTaskRunner> interceptor_task_runner_;
  mojo::Remote<network::mojom::URLLoaderClient> test_client_remote_;
  std::unique_ptr<mojo::Receiver<network::mojom::URLLoaderClient>>
      test_client_receiver_;
};

// These tests verify that the browser process blocks cross-site HTML, XML,
// JSON, and some plain text responses when they are not otherwise permitted
// (e.g., by CORS).  This ensures that such responses never end up in the
// renderer process where they might be accessible via a bug.  Careful attention
// is paid to allow other cross-site resources necessary for rendering,
// including cases that may be mislabeled as blocked MIME type.
class C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ase : public ContentBrowserTest {
 public:
  C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ase() = default;
  ~C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ase() override = default;

  // No copy constructor or assignment.
  C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ase(const C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ase&) =
      delete;
  C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ase& operator=(
      const C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ase&) = delete;

  void SetUpCommandLine(base::CommandLine* command_line) override {
    // EmbeddedTestServer::InitializeAndListen() initializes its |base_url_|
    // which is required below. This cannot invoke Start() however as that kicks
    // off the "EmbeddedTestServer IO Thread" which then races with
    // initialization in ContentBrowserTest::SetUp(), http://crbug.com/674545.
    // Additionally the server should not be started prior to setting up
    // ControllableHttpResponse(s) in some individual tests below.
    ASSERT_TRUE(embedded_test_server()->InitializeAndListen());

    // Add a host resolver rule to map all outgoing requests to the test server.
    // This allows us to use "real" hostnames and standard ports in URLs (i.e.,
    // without having to inject the port number into all URLs), which we can use
    // to create arbitrary SiteInstances.
    command_line->AppendSwitchASCII(
        network::switches::kHostResolverRules,
        "MAP * " + embedded_test_server()->host_port_pair().ToString() +
            ",EXCLUDE localhost");
  }
};

// The following are files under content/test/data/site_isolation. All
// should be disallowed for cross site XHR under the document blocking policy.
//   valid.*        - Correctly labeled HTML/XML/JSON files.
//   *.txt          - Plain text that sniffs as HTML, XML, or JSON.
//   htmlN_dtd.*    - Various HTML templates to test.
//   json-prefixed* - parser-breaking prefixes
IMG_TEST(valid_html, "valid.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(valid_xml, "valid.xml",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(valid_json, "valid.json",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(html_txt, "html.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(xml_txt, "xml.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_txt, "json.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_octet_stream, "json.octet-stream",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(comment_valid_html, "comment_valid.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(html4_dtd_html, "html4_dtd.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(html4_dtd_txt, "html4_dtd.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(html5_dtd_html, "html5_dtd.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(html5_dtd_txt, "html5_dtd.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_js, "json.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_prefixed_1_js, "json-prefixed-1.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_prefixed_2_js, "json-prefixed-2.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_prefixed_3_js, "json-prefixed-3.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(json_prefixed_4_js, "json-prefixed-4.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(nosniff_json_js, "nosniff.json.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(nosniff_json_prefixed_js,
         "nosniff.json-prefixed.js",
         k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)

// ORB blocks responses with non-image/audio/video MIME type that don't
// sniff as Javascript (ORBv0.1 blocks ones that sniff as HTML or XML or JSON).
IMG_TEST(html_octet_stream, "html.octet-stream",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)
IMG_TEST(xml_octet_stream, "xml.octet-stream", kShouldBeSniffedAndBlocked)

// ORB detects audio/video responses before the final Javascript sniffing (or in
// the case of ORBv0.1, confirmation sniffing for HTML/XML/JSON).  This
// sequencing simplifies the ORB algorithm and implementation because it means
// that the final sniffing step doesn't need to take into account media content.
// OTOH, if ORB detects some audio/video responses based on the MIME type of the
// response, then it may allow some cases that ORB would block - such as a JSON
// response incorrectly labeled as "audio/x-wav".
IMG_TEST(json_wav, "json.wav",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)

// These files should be disallowed without sniffing.
//   nosniff.*   - Won't sniff correctly, but blocked because of nosniff.
IMG_TEST(nosniff_html, "nosniff.html", k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ing)
IMG_TEST(nosniff_xml, "nosniff.xml", k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ing)
IMG_TEST(nosniff_json, "nosniff.json", k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ing)
IMG_TEST(nosniff_txt, "nosniff.txt", k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ing)
IMG_TEST(fake_pdf, "fake.pdf", k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ing)
IMG_TEST(fake_zip, "fake.zip", k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ing)

// These files are allowed for XHR under the document blocking policy because
// the sniffing logic determines they are not actually documents.
//   *js.*   - JavaScript mislabeled as a document.
//   jsonp.* - JSONP (i.e., script) mislabeled as a document.
//   img.*   - Contents that won't match the document label.
//   valid.* - Correctly labeled responses of non-document types.
IMG_TEST(html_prefix_txt, "html-prefix.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(js_html, "js.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(comment_js_html, "comment_js.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(js_xml, "js.xml",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(js_json, "js.json",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(js_txt, "js.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(jsonp_html, "jsonp.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(jsonp_xml, "jsonp.xml",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(jsonp_json, "jsonp.json",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(jsonp_txt, "jsonp.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(img_html, "img.html",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(img_xml, "img.xml",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(img_json, "img.json",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(img_txt, "img.txt",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(valid_js, "valid.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(json_list_js, "json-list.js",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(nosniff_json_list_js,
         "nosniff.json-list.js",
         k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(js_html_polyglot_html,
         "js-html-polyglot.html",
         k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
IMG_TEST(js_html_polyglot2_html,
         "js-html-polyglot2.html",
         k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)

// ORB allows, because even with 'XCTO: nosniff' ORB will sniff that this is an
// image.
IMG_TEST(nosniff_png, "nosniff.png.octet-stream",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)
// Like nosniff_png above, except that ORB v0.1 allows because HLS/m3u8 doesn't
// sniff as HTML/XML/JSON.
IMG_TEST(m3u8_octet_stream, "m3u8.octet-stream", k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ed)

IN_PROC_BROWSER_TEST_F(C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ase,
                       HeadersBlockedInResponseBlockedByCorb) {
  embedded_test_server()->StartAcceptingConnections();

  // Prepare to intercept the network request at the IPC layer.
  // This has to be done before the RenderFrameHostImpl is created.
  //
  // Note: we want to verify that the blocking prevents the data from being sent
  // over IPC.  Testing later (e.g. via Response/Headers Web APIs) might give a
  // false sense of security, since some sanitization happens inside the
  // renderer (e.g. via FetchResponseData::CreateCorsFilteredResponse).
  GURL bar_url("http://bar.com/cross_site_document_blocking/headers-test.json");
  RequestInterceptor interceptor(bar_url);

  // Navigate to the test page.
  GURL foo_url("http://foo.com/title1.html");
  EXPECT_TRUE(NavigateToURL(shell(), foo_url));

  // Issue the request that will be intercepted.
  const char kScriptTemplate[] = R"(
      var img = document.createElement('img');
      img.src = $1;
      document.body.appendChild(img); )";
  EXPECT_TRUE(ExecJs(shell(), JsReplace(kScriptTemplate, bar_url)));
  interceptor.WaitForRequestCompletion();

  // Verify that the response completed successfully, was blocked and was logged
  // as having initially a non-empty body.
  interceptor.Verify(BlockAsError(kShouldBeBlockedWithoutSniffing),
                     "no resource body needed for blocking verification");

  // Verify that the error response has no head and no body.
  EXPECT_FALSE(interceptor.response_head());
  EXPECT_EQ("", interceptor.response_body());
}

IN_PROC_BROWSER_TEST_F(CrossSiteDocumentBlockingTestBase,
                       HeadersSanitizedInCrossOriginResponseAllowedByCorb) {
  embedded_test_server()->StartAcceptingConnections();

  // Prepare to intercept the network request at the IPC layer.
  // This has to be done before the RenderFrameHostImpl is created.
  //
  // Note: we want to verify that the blocking prevents the data from being sent
  // over IPC.  Testing later (e.g. via Response/Headers Web APIs) might give a
  // false sense of security, since some sanitization happens inside the
  // renderer (e.g. via FetchResponseData::CreateCorsFilteredResponse).
  GURL bar_url("http://bar.com/cross_site_document_blocking/headers-test.png");
  RequestInterceptor interceptor(bar_url);
  std::string png_body =
      GetTestFileContents("cross_site_document_blocking", "headers-test.png");

  // Navigate to the test page.
  GURL foo_url("http://foo.com/title1.html");
  EXPECT_TRUE(NavigateToURL(shell(), foo_url));

  // Issue the request that will be intercepted.
  const char kScriptTemplate[] = R"(
      var img = document.createElement('img');
      img.src = $1;
      document.body.appendChild(img); )";
  EXPECT_TRUE(ExecJs(shell(), JsReplace(kScriptTemplate, bar_url)));
  interceptor.WaitForRequestCompletion();

  // Verify that the response completed successfully, was *not* blocked and
  // returned the full `png_body`.
  interceptor.Verify(kShouldBeSniffedAndAllowed, png_body);

  // Verify that most response headers have been allowed by ORB.
  const std::string& headers =
      interceptor.response_head()->headers->raw_headers();
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("Cache-Control"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("Content-Length"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("Content-Type"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("Expires"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("Last-Modified"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("Pragma"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("X-Content-Type-Options"));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, HasSubstr("X-My-Secret-Header"));

  // Verify that the body has been allowed by ORB.
  EXPECT_EQ(png_body, interceptor.response_body());
  EXPECT_EQ(static_cast<int64_t>(png_body.size()),
            interceptor.completion_status().decoded_body_length);
  EXPECT_EQ(static_cast<int64_t>(png_body.size()),
            interceptor.response_head()->content_length);

  // MAIN VERIFICATION: Verify that despite allowing the response in ORB, we
  // stripped out the cookies (i.e. the cookies present in
  // cross_site_document_blocking/headers-test.png.mock-http-headers).
  //
  // This verification helps ensure that no cross-origin secrets are disclosed
  // in no-cors responses.
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, Not(HasSubstr("MySecretPlainCookieKey")));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, Not(HasSubstr("MySecretCookieValue1")));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, Not(HasSubstr("MySecretHttpOnlyCookieKey")));
  EXPECT_THAT(headers, Not(HasSubstr("MySecretCookieValue2")));
}
